Phase One: Campaign Strategy and Setup

Before launching any campaign, your VA should complete a strategic planning process. This starts with defining the campaign objective, whether that is awareness, traffic, leads, or sales. The objective determines every subsequent decision, from audience selection to bidding strategy to creative format.

Next, your VA develops the audience strategy. For each campaign, they should define the primary target audience using demographics, interests, and behaviors, create custom audiences from your existing data such as email lists and website visitors, build lookalike audiences from your best customer segments, and define exclusion audiences to prevent overlap and waste.

Creative planning follows audience strategy. Your VA should plan at least three to five creative variations for each campaign, covering different visual formats, messaging angles, and calls to action. Each variation should be tied to a specific hypothesis about what will resonate with the target audience. This structured approach to creative testing produces insights that improve performance over time, rather than the random guessing that characterizes most DIY ad management.

Campaign setup includes configuring the pixel or Conversions API for accurate tracking, setting up conversion events that align with your business goals, choosing the appropriate bid strategy, and defining budget allocation across campaigns and ad sets. Your VA should document all setup decisions so they can be referenced during optimization and reporting. Phase Two: Daily Monitoring and Optimization

Once campaigns are live, daily management is what determines whether they succeed or fail. Your VA’s daily workflow should follow a consistent pattern. Morning starts with a performance dashboard review, checking spend pacing, cost per result, and any anomalies that need immediate attention. If a campaign is overspending or underperforming dramatically, your VA adjusts budgets or pauses ad sets before the issue consumes more budget.

Midday is for deeper analysis and optimization. Your VA reviews performance at the ad set and ad level, identifying which audiences and creatives are performing best. They shift budget toward top performers and reduce spend on underperformers. They check frequency metrics to catch ad fatigue early and plan creative refreshes before performance degrades.

Afternoon tasks include engagement management, responding to comments on ads, hiding spam, and answering questions. Your VA should also check for any ad disapprovals or account issues that might affect delivery. Before ending the day, they note any observations or concerns that should be addressed in the next day’s session.

This daily rhythm ensures that your campaigns are never running unattended for more than a few hours. Problems are caught early, opportunities are captured quickly, and optimization is continuous rather than periodic. Phase Three: Weekly Creative Testing and Audience Refinement

Weekly tasks build on the daily optimization work by addressing the two most impactful levers in Meta advertising: creative and audience. Every week, your VA should review creative performance across all active campaigns, identifying winning and losing ad variations. Losing ads are paused and replaced with new tests, ensuring that the creative pool stays fresh and performance continues to improve.

The weekly creative review should also identify patterns. Are video ads outperforming static images? Do certain color schemes or visual styles generate more engagement? Do short-form or long-form captions drive more clicks? Your VA documents these patterns and uses them to inform future creative development, building an ever-growing understanding of what your specific audience responds to.

Audience refinement happens weekly as well. Your VA reviews audience performance data, narrowing audiences that are generating impressions but not conversions, and expanding audiences that are converting well but have limited reach. They update custom audiences with fresh data, create new lookalike audiences based on recent converters, and test new interest-based segments.

Weekly is also the time for your VA to update you on campaign performance. A brief weekly summary, delivered via email or Slack, should cover the key metrics, what is working, what is not, and any actions taken or planned. This keeps you informed without requiring a formal meeting every week.

Phase Four: Monthly Reporting and Strategic Review

Monthly reporting is where your VA synthesizes daily and weekly data into strategic insights. The monthly report should include a high-level performance summary comparing current month to previous months, a breakdown of results by campaign, audience, and creative type, insights about what drove the best and worst performance, a summary of tests conducted and their results, and recommendations for the coming month’s strategy, budget, and creative direction.

The monthly review is also when your VA should evaluate whether the overall campaign strategy is still aligned with your business goals. Market conditions change, product offerings evolve, and seasonal patterns affect performance. Your VA should proactively recommend strategy adjustments rather than waiting for you to identify issues.

Budget allocation across campaigns should be reviewed monthly based on performance trends. Your VA should propose shifts that move spend toward the highest-performing campaigns and reduce investment in those that are not delivering. They should also flag any upcoming events, holidays, or promotions that require campaign adjustments.

This monthly strategic review ensures that your Meta Ads investment stays aligned with your broader business objectives and adapts to changing conditions rather than running on autopilot.
